New problem with KB4462933 on a Microsoft Surface Pro 2017 - after installing this patch, I did my normal shutdown (Start>Power>Shutdown) at the end of the day with 100% battery, when I try to switch on in the morning there is 0% battery. After doing a little investigation, something in this update is consuming huge amounts of power when the machine is "off" - the device is getting really hot and the battery goes from 100% to 75% in under 10 minutes.

Solution was to uninstall KB4462933, now eveything is back to normal - battery 100% last night at power down, still 100% this morning at switchon - Good job Microsoft another half a day of my life wasted and on your own device as well!
